Crazy House
By 11:30 a.m., you’ll visit the Crazy House—widely regarded as one of the world’s top ten most bizarre buildings. This architecturally wild guesthouse is a must-see for its sculptural, organic shapes resembling caves, animals, and mushrooms. Constructed in 1990 and designed by architect Dang Viet Nga, the building is a delightful example of expressionist architecture, making it a favorite for travelers seeking something out of the ordinary.

Dalat Railway Station and Museum
Post-lunch, around 1:45 p.m., the group visits the Dalat Railway Station, designed in 1932 by French architects Moncet & Reveron. Opened in 1938, this station exemplifies colonial-era architecture, with its charming, vintage charm and well-preserved details. It’s a favorite for history buffs and architecture fans alike and offers great photo opportunities.
Domaine de Marie Church
Next, at 2:30 p.m., the tour includes a visit to this tranquil Catholic convent and church. Built in 1940, its French-Vietnamese architectural style and peaceful gardens make it a lovely spot to take a break from the busier sights. The church is still operational, hosting local schooling and religious services, giving visitors a glimpse into Dalat’s spiritual life.

Linh Phuoc Pagoda
By 3:45 p.m., you’ll visit the impressive Linh Phuoc Pagoda, built in 1949. Its intricate porcelain carvings and impressive structures make it a standout religious site in Dalat. The pagoda’s colorful mosaics and detailed craftsmanship reflect local artistry and dedication, and it’s a popular attraction for visitors interested in Vietnam’s religious architecture.
